Publishers Weekly

Vivian Vande Velde spins 13 systematically scary yarns that all take place on All Hallows' Eve. Readers encounter a car possessed by a vengeful spirit, a mausoleum inhabited by a murderer and a family of ghosts as well as other creatures that will give them goosebumps. About the Author, Vivian Vande Velde

VIVIAN VANDE VELDE has written many books for teen and middle grade readers, including All Hallow's Eve: 13 Stories, Three Good Deeds, Now You See It ..., Heir Apparent, and the Edgar Award-winning Never Trust a Dead Man. She lives in Rochester, New York.
